Handover note — dispatch desk, evening shift. Tomas: the master copies for Pellworth Print Co. are boxed and sealed on shelf B, marked in red tape. These are the only corrected originals for the Averly catalogue run, so nothing leaves without sign-off from Greta upstairs. The client confirmed the press slot for Wednesday, meaning the box has to go out first thing. A rider from Osprey Courier Collective is booked for 08:00; the confidential hand-over line is noted directly below.

handover note for yagef-bagep: the drudor pelius courier leaves the kasdor zorvan norir ledger at gate 8016 under passcode 755406

For the weekly eng sync: the Tumblecrate locker access flow is now live in staging. A user scans the locker QR, the app requests a one-time unlock grant from the Hasplane access service, and the locker firmware validates it offline within a 30-second window. Failed grants fall back to attendant override. Two open items: grant expiry drift on older firmware, and metrics gaps during peak hours. To exercise the flow end to end, authenticate against Hasplane with the staging key below.

gateway credential: kto23_LX9A4ys6i4nzHtpOLNLodKK

# FY Headcount Plan — Managers Only

This page outlines Bravellin Systems' headcount plan for next year, prepared for the board. Total approved growth is 42 roles: 19 in engineering for the Quellbase platform, 11 in field sales across the Marovia region, 8 in support, and 4 in finance. Backfills are capped at 90% of attrition. Hiring freezes apply to non-critical corporate functions until the second half. Strategic context for these numbers is noted below.

confidential, kagup-bafog: Fraaxax Group is in early talks to buy Soroxox Group for about $343.8 million. The Olidor launch date is June 14, and nothing goes to the press before then. Legal wants the Aldmirek Logistics term sheet signed before July 23.